On tour My wife and I found Whispering Pines to be clean and well managed. [Name removed] , the administrator was an RN there before she took her current position so she has a lot of practical experience as well. The staff seemed happy and engaged with the residents. The memory care area has a nice little courtyard to go into with plants to tend if they so desire. They also allow some of those residents who still have some high level function to crossover into the regular assisted living areas to participate in their activities(supervised). We also got the sense that they are little more laid back (not sloppy, just informal)than other places we have visited. Definitely a contender
